Denver, September 10, 2024. — EGYM, a leader in fitness technology solutions, is proud to announce its recent acceptance of a Sourcewell cooperative purchasing contract in the fitness equipment category. This allows EGYM to expand its offerings to public agencies across North America.
Sourcewell, a self-funded governmental organization established in 1978, facilitates a cooperative purchasing program that harnesses the collective purchasing power of more than 50,000 participating agencies. By streamlining procurement with pre-negotiated, competitive contracts, Sourcewell enables government, educational, and nonprofit organizations to secure cost-effective and efficient purchasing solutions.
EGYM secured a Sourcewell contract following a rigorous request for proposal (RFP) process, ensuring compliance with local procurement requirements, and delivering exceptional value and service. This partnership grants any public agency access to purchase from EGYM through a ready-to-use, Sourcewell-vetted contract, streamlining the public purchasing process.
